An atomic explosion awakens Gammera--a giant, fire-breathing turtle monster--from his millions of years of hibernation. Enraged at being roused from such a sound sleep, he takes it out on Tokyo.

Trivia | This is the only film in the series that was filmed entirely in black and white. See more » |
Movie Connections | Edited from Gamera: The Giant Monster (1965). See more » |
